secretly柯林斯释义

ADJ-GRADED秘密的;机密的;保密的

If something is secret, it is known about by only a small number of people, and is not told or shown to anyone else.

  • Soldiers have been training at a secret location...

    士兵们一直在一个秘密场所训练。

  • The police have been trying to keep the documents secret.

    警方一直设法将这些文件保密。

N-COUNT秘密;机密;内情

A secret is a fact that is known by only a small number of people, and is not told to anyone else.

  • I think he enjoyed keeping our love a secret...

    我觉得他喜欢和我偷偷摸摸地谈恋爱。

  • I didn't want anyone to know about it, it was my secret.

    我不想任何人知道这件事,这是我的秘密。

N-SING秘诀;诀窍

If you say that a particular way of doing things is the secret of achieving something, you mean that it is the best or only way to achieve it.

  • The secret of success is honesty and fair dealing...

    成功的秘诀在于诚实和公平交易。

  • I learned something about writing. The secret is to say less than you need.

    我学过一点写作方面的技巧,秘诀就是欲说还休。

N-COUNT奥秘;奥妙

Something's secrets are the things about it which have never been fully explained.

  • We have an opportunity now to really unlock the secrets of the universe...

    我们现在有机会去真正解开宇宙的奥秘。

  • The past is riddled with deep dark secrets.

    过去承载了诸多不可告人的惊天秘密。

PHRASE秘密地;暗地里

If you do something in secret, you do it without anyone else knowing.

  • Dan found out that I had been meeting my ex-boyfriend in secret.

    丹发现我一直在跟前男友偷偷见面。

PHRASE保守秘密

If you say that someone can keep a secret, you mean that they can be trusted not to tell other people a secret that you have told them.

  • Tom was utterly indiscreet, and could never keep a secret.

    汤姆言语很不谨慎,什么时候也别想他守住秘密。

PHRASE不隐瞒;开诚布公

If you make no secret of something, you tell others about it openly and clearly.

  • His wife made no secret of her hatred for the formal occasions...

    他的妻子公开表示厌恶那些礼节性的场合。

  • Ministers are making no secret about their wish to buy American weapons.

    部长们毫不隐瞒他们想要购买美国武器的愿望。

secretly英文释义

Adverb

1. in secrecy; not openly;

  • met secretly to discuss the invasion plans
  • the children secretly went to the movies when they were supposed to be at the library
  • they arranged to meet in secret

2. not openly; inwardly;

  • they were secretly delighted at his embarrassment
  • hoped secretly she would change her mind
